Education
Education shapes the future by building knowledge, creativity, and opportunity for all while giving us the building blocks for solving pressing global challenges and enhancing quality of life. The National Academies examine how students learn, how teachers can be supported, and how systems can promote future generations of learners. Gulf Research Program Welcomes Six Universities to Interdisciplinary Gulf Scholars Program
News Release
The Gulf Research Program (GRP) of the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ine announced today the addition of six colleges and universities to the Gulf Scholars Program, a five-year, $12.7 million pilot program that prepares undergraduate students to address pressing environmental, health, energy, and infrastructure challenges in the Gulf Coast region.
